White cloudy fluid in urine is usually pathological in origin. Bacterial infections, prostatitis, gynecological diseases, urinary tract infections, dietary factors, and many other causes can cause urine to become white and cloudy. Normal human urine is pale yellow or colorless and is clear and transparent, and does not appear cloudy. If there is a bacterial infection in the urinary system, there will be many white cells and inflammatory tissue fragments in the urine, so there will be white and cloudy urine, which is usually accompanied by symptoms such as frequent, urgent and painful urination. The main reason for this is that the prostate gland is inflamed and secretes prostate fluid, which is mixed in with the urine, making the urine look white and cloudy, so white cloudy urine is a typical symptom of prostatitis. Some serious gynecological diseases, such as mycosis vaginalis, trichomonas vaginalis, inflammatory substances can repeatedly irritate the urethra thus causing the urine color white cloudy. Urinary tract infection is also an important cause of white cloudy urine. After the infection, the local mucous membrane on the surface of the urethra will be broken, and a large amount of epidermal tissue will be mixed in the urine to make the urine cloudy.
